Octomom’s octuplets turn 15 – their lives now
Natalie “Octomom” Suleman became famous in 2009 after giving birth to the world’s first surviving octuplets, expanding her family to 14 children. The pregnancies were the result of IVF overseen by Dr. Michael Kamrava, whose medical license was later revoked for gross negligence after implanting 12 embryos.
